Optimization of GC detector parameters using electronic pressure control
Authors:Kenneth J Klein  Paul A Larson  Jill A Breckenridge
Abstract:HP 5890 Series II Gas Chromatographs are equipped with prototype hardware enabling electronic pressure programming of all detector and carrier gases. A method of using electronic pressure control (EPC) to optimize detector performance (sensitivity, selectivity, and baseline stability) is demonstrated. With EPC, sample introduction, column separation, and detector performance can be optimized simultaneously without the classical trade-offs in performance. An example is also presented of the use of a new automated system which enables cool on-column injection into 250 or 320 μm columns without the need for a retention gap.
Keywords:Capillary GC  Splitless injection  Electronic pressure control (EPC)  Nitrogen –  phosphorus detector (NPD)  Flame photometric detector (FPD)  Flame ionization detector (FID)  Programmable cool on-column injection
